From Anne Arundel County to Leonardtown by bus
To get from Anne Arundel County to Leonardtown in Washington, D.C. - Baltimore, MD, you’ll need to take 3 bus lines: take the FLIXBUS 2601 bus from West St & Calvert St station to Washington Union Station station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 735 bus and finally take the 2 bus from Charlotte Hall Food Lion station to Md 5 And Washington St. (Burchmart) station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 4 hr 24 min. The bus schedule from Anne Arundel County may change.
